Transaction 051ea6abab025d699a460591414baff30d4496060e676fe722e6037b35b8fbe6
1 Input
1 Output
-
051ea6abab025d699a460591414baff30d4496060e676fe722e6037b35b8fbe6:0
- value
- 1729344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ca44a4bf3b8c2ababd642102ad35a31d8478e59a OP_EQUAL
- address
- 3L8WejKanX6ZShaf1QiTqabBtzMEY9vbqP